Birds.ai turns visual inspection into insights for operations and maintenance of critical assets and infrastructure. To achieve that, we convert images into meaningful figures and numbers so that our customer can manage these assets and infrastructure in a sustainable way. We automatically analyse images to identify objects, anomalies, and defects using our in-house developed software. We are looking for an intern to develop Computer Vision and Machine Learning algorithms to detect and track objects in images.
We are a small team and thus your work will have a huge impact on the technology we use and build to provide customers with valuable inisghts!

We are giving our customers a bird's-eye view of their wind turbines, so that they can take better decisions about maintenance and prevent any unnecessary downtime.
We hire a drone operator to collect images of the whole turbine.
We use Artificial Intelligence to create Artificial Inspectors that automatically find damages and defects in all of these images.
We visualize this information to give our customers a Birds.ai View of their wind turbines.
We are building the technology to predict and show how damages and defects might involve in the future.
